§ 390g–4. Authorization of appropriations to carry out phase I

There is authorized to be appropriated $500,000 for fiscal years beginning after September 30, 1983 , to carry out phase I. Amounts shall be made available pursuant to the authorization contained in this section in a single sum for all demonstration project sites, and it shall be within the discretion of the Secretary to apportion such sum among such sites. ( Pub. L. 98–434, § 6 , Sept. 28, 1984 , 98 Stat. 1677 .)
